    nic_avalon wrote: »
    Hello, I have I a question similar to Sarnd's please! I need to return a moisturiser to Boots because I bought it for my Mum and she has previously had a reaction to it which I didn't know about :eek: I no longer have the receipt, will I be allowed to exchange/ have a refund by way of AC points or a gift card?

    Thank to anyone in the know!!
    Boots policy is that if you have had a reaction to a boots 'own' brand item, either with or without a receipt,
    they will refund your money in full. You need to stress that this is the reason for the item being returned.
    Otherwise it will be at the discretion of the SA who serves you (as you have no proof of purchase)
    and the item would have to be intact and sealed. HTH :).
